Delivery of Active DACH-Pt Anticancer Species by Biodegradable Amphiphilic Polymers Using Thiol-Ene Radical Addition

中文摘要a biodegradable and amphiphilic copolymer, mpeg-b-p(la-co-mac/tma) that contains pendant 1,2-bidentate carboxyl groups is synthesized by thiol-ene radical addition and is further used to chelate with the active anticancer species (dach-pt) of oxaliplatin to form an mpeg-b-p(la-co-mac/tma-pt-dach) complex. the polymer platinum complex can self-assemble into micelles. in vitro studies show that the dach-pt micelles display enhanced or comparable cytotoxicity against skov-3 and mcf-7 cancer cells, while they show reduced toxicity to hela cells compared with oxaliplatin.
